Bill Belichick debut attracts UNC legends to Kenan Memorial Stadium
Posted Sep 3, 2025
We knew that the star power would be out and about at Kenan Stadium for Bill Belichick's debut with UNC football, but the university put together a major flex by having a trio of legends sitting together. The trio of Michael Jordan, Roy Williams, and Lawrence Taylor was shown on the ESPN broadcast enjoying the UNC's season opener together.
